The Best Winter Tours in the World

1. Copper Canyon, Meksiko
Tourists may be surprised to see two permanent snow-covered and glaciated volcanoes—Popocatepetl and Iztaccihuatl in Mexico City. You can see Mexico’s highest mountain Pico de Orizaba, which is 18,500 feet above sea level and climb Copper Canyon.

In winter, it is often covered in snow, while the lowlands are 30 degrees warmer.

2. Dunton, Colorado
For an incredible winter experience, Dunton Hot Springs in Telluride, Colorado. The place is surrounded by mineral-enriched hot springs that have been used for centuries for their healing properties.

“19th century baths with private hot springs and enjoy soaking under the starry sky as snow falls, will make an unforgettable impression.

3. Minaret Station, New Zealand
Minaret Station, New Zealand is only accessible by helicopter and is surrounded by unspoiled nature. It’s no surprise that this place is stunning at any time of the year.

Staying in winter in New Zealand (June-August), you can go heli-skiing untracked and access to over 800 ski runs for everyone. There is a warm hot tub waiting for you when you return to the accommodation.

4. Tuktoyaktuk, Canada
Visiting Tuktoyaktuk in the Northwest Territories of Canada will make a sweet impression in your life. The weather is quite cold, but one can ride a snowmobile on the frozen sea ice of the Arctic Ocean, ride a sled across the tundra and see the Northern Lights in the same day.

You can meet indigenous people who share their culture and eat food together, such as muktuk (whales), moose, caribou and other large animals from the Arctic.

5. Ladakh, India
For an adventurous winter experience, go trekking to see snow leopards in Ladakh, high in the Himalayas, India. Even experienced safari lovers often overlook this remote and beautiful region. Many animals can be seen there.
